Can the police track your phone if its off?
The phone does not have to be actively engaged in a call to be connected to cells, but it must be turned on; phones in the "off" position or those with no batteries do not register with the cellular carrier's network and cannot be tracked.

Can WhatsApp call be tapped?
However, since chats and phone calls through platforms like WhatsApp are encrypted, these cannot be intercepted during transmission. The police can nonetheless legally access data stored on a phone or a computer.

How do I delete my WhatsApp history?
Step 1: First of all, you have to tap More options present in the Chats tab and then, select Settings. Step 2: Then, you need to select Chats and then, tap Chat history. Step 3: Here, you have to tap Clear all chats. Step 4: Now, you need to check or uncheck Delete starred messages and Delete media in chats.

How do I permanently delete files?
To permanently delete a file:
Press and hold the Shift key, then press the Delete key on your keyboard. Because you cannot undo this, you will be asked to confirm that you want to delete the file or folder.
